In Michael Barr's song "Worthless," the lyrics reflect a troubled mindset of a person who struggles to find meaning in their life. The first verse sets the tone for the song, as the singer describes himself as a man without a plan, just rolling with the bat to the practice. The following lines, "Take me to my casket, yeah/ I don't think you fully understand," suggest that the singer is not only aimless but also on a self-destructive path. However, despite this, he takes a chance on himself and pours himself into his work, even if it means indulging in drugs.
In the chorus, the singer's emotional turmoil is laid bare as he asks to be told that he is not worthless and that he will not die alone. The second verse is more visceral and centers around his relationship with a woman who keeps him up all night and helps him forget his pain. Nevertheless, the singer is still searching for something more, something that will make him feel high enough. The final lines of the song, "When your driving me wild, you're insane/ Tell me I'm worthless," suggest that the singer sees worthlessness as a self-fulfilling prophecy and that he may be in a destructive cycle that is difficult to break.
